LINUX.ORG.RU

Вышел Visual Studio Code 1.2

 ,


0

4

Вышел майский релиз VS Code.

VS Code (Visual Studio Code) — редактор кода, основанный на фреймворке Atom Shell (или Electron), который разработан GitHub и используется также в редакторе Atom.

Стоит обратить внимание на то, что Microsoft разделяет названия vscode и Visual Studio Code. Как и в случае с Google Chrome и Chromium, Visual Studio Code построена на исходном коде vscode и, по сути, является его брендированной версией со своими опциями сборки. Данный вариант распространяется под проприетарной лицензией. Более подробно об этом можно прочитать в Issues на GitHub. vscode же лицензирован под MIT.

Вкратце об изменениях:

  • Редактор: можно обрезать автоматически расставляемые пробелы, новое сочетание клавиш для выбора всех совпадений в тексте, можно изменять размеры окна Peek.
  • Linting: ESLint теперь поддерживает опцию «пофиксить все ошибки».
  • Языки: автодополнение IntelliSense, Go To, Peek definition (посмотреть определение) и «найти все места использования переменной» для CSS, SCSS и LESS.
  • Workbench: можно использовать терминал вашей ОС прямо из редактора, удалять биндинги (сочетания) клавиш, исправлены проблемы с табами.
  • Отладка: улучшена Debug Console, исправлены проблемы с производительностью Node.js.
  • Расширения: можно перечислять, устанавливать и удалять расширения из командной строки.

>>> Исходный код

>>> Подробности

★★★

Проверено: Falcon-peregrinus ()
Последнее исправление: Falcon-peregrinus (всего исправлений: 6)
Ответ на: комментарий от RazrFalcon

в rpm 64 забыли положить скрипт в /usr/bin :(

anonymous
()

Тоесть надо не помогать существующему проекту развивая его инфраструктуру, а создавать «свой» форк?

Типичный микрософт

Khades ★★
()
Ответ на: комментарий от samy_volosaty

Ты про комьюнити? У нее уж как второй апдейт пошел, чему там умирать? Все расширения в первую очередь для нее.

ritsufag ★★★★★
()
Ответ на: комментарий от snizovtsev

Не знаю как этот vscode, но Atom по ощущениям шустрее многих эклипсов будет.

Угу. Как текстовый редактор. А как IDE, Eclipse это поделие рвет на британский флаг.

no-dashi ★★★★★
()
Ответ на: комментарий от no-dashi

А как IDE, Eclipse это поделие рвет на британский флаг.

Плагины для Eclipse пишут уже 15 лет.

tailgunner ★★★★★
()

Microsoft никогда не устанет заниматься хернёй:

"telemetry.enableTelemetry": true

И это в настройках по умолчанию. Теперь они ещё и чужой код просматривают. Бойкот этим тварям, их продукция в 2016 уже не незаменима.

lagavulin16
()
Ответ на: комментарий от andreyu

Для hello world вкладки бесполезны, а для проектов большего размера вредны.

А лазить туда сюда по дереву проекта не вредно?

anonymous
()
Ответ на: комментарий от RazrFalcon

Sublime не совсем нативный - там движок на Python, но работает он не в пример этим новомодным Chromium: и запускается моментом и плагины есть очень толковые для sass, less, coffee, jade, go, D, django/rails.

menangen ★★★★★
()
Ответ на: комментарий от lagavulin16

Это тебе чем-то мешает?

Теперь они ещё и чужой код просматривают

1. Твой код никому им не нужен

2. Пруф в студию.

Unicode4all ★★★★★
()
Ответ на: комментарий от menangen

Я к тому, что связка gtk + python на порядки лучше, чем Electron + JS. Тупо по любому показателю.

Сколько конкретно работы выполняет python в sublime - без понятия.

RazrFalcon ★★★★★
()
Ответ на: комментарий от Jack-Laphroaig

Там есть предположение, что это из-за узкоспециализированности vscode против atom.
Плюс там переделана подсветка и переделана до глюкавого состояния мультикурсорность.

andreyu ★★★★★
()
Ответ на: комментарий от anonymous

vscode наоборот быстрее оригинального atom.

Постом выше есть ссылка на обсуждение. Там есть предположение, почему такая разница в скорости.
Впрочем это похоже на сравнение сортов говна - какое из них вкуснее.

andreyu ★★★★★
()
Ответ на: комментарий от ritsufag

Ты про комьюнити?

ну да. а что ещё ставить на посмотреть?, в виртуалку? протухла и говорить нет лицензии... хочу домой сходить. я не пустил.

samy_volosaty ★★★★★
()
Ответ на: комментарий от samy_volosaty

Очередной неосилятор.

через месяц протухла (а кто-то кричал тут, что бесплатно раздают)

Если подумать головой и почитать ошибки которые она выдает, можно увидеть, что по истечении месяца надо зарегестрироваться. Тебе черным по белому пишут, что осталось 30 дней до регистрации, когда запускаешь. Регистрация бесплатна.

так и этот редактор жрёт, наверное, кучу ресурсов.

Тебе, наверное, стоит проверять факты прежде чем постить фигню.

т.е. исправляет код? :-)

В гугле забанили? Можешь почитать, что такое линтинг.

spec_po_kiskam ★★★
() автор топика
Ответ на: комментарий от lagavulin16

Тебе есть что скрывать? :) По-моему плагин такой-же как у Атома. Только у Атома он не включен по умолчанию вроде.

spec_po_kiskam ★★★
() автор топика
Ответ на: комментарий от spec_po_kiskam

Пока нечего, но важен прецедент. ПО от Майкрософт заболело этим раком первым, метастазы пошли по всей проприетарщине, все эти статистики, телеметрия, предпочтения, местоположение, привязки к интернету, в 10-ке ещё и кейлоггер. А пипл хавает, «мне нечего скрывать», проприетарщики скоро обнаглеют вконец, не чувствуя противодействия. Когда будет что скрывать, будет уже поздно. Пользуйтесь свободным ПО!

lagavulin16
()
Ответ на: комментарий от lagavulin16

Пользуйтесь свободным ПО

Ну вот как только оно дойдет до того состояния, когда им можно будет пользоваться - так сразу. А пока лучше пойду, поставлю обновление для VS Code.

Jack-Laphroaig
()

Кто в курсе: откуда такой лютый ШГ на скрине с гитахаба?

Вроде бы с мака, но даже для него какой-то УГ.

RazrFalcon ★★★★★
()
Ответ на: комментарий от spec_po_kiskam

Очередной неосилятор.

да просто не очень надо как-то. если вдруг что под оффтопик собрать - есть mingw.

а править код - есть куча свободных IDE ничуть не хуже (anjuta, qt-creator, netbeans, eclipse и т.д.);

samy_volosaty ★★★★★
()
Ответ на: комментарий от FiXer

а время установки? за это время gcc пересобирётся. а сколько она выкачивает... был образ комьюнити-эдишн. так она на половину выругалась, что файлы битые.

потом снести не смог, говорит это файл повреждён, укажите другой или дай я скачаю...

в итоге я стёр и виртуалку и образ - задолбала :-)

я лучше, если комп нечем занять будет, мир пересоберу, и то веселее.

samy_volosaty ★★★★★
()

Очень хорош в связке с Golang, рекомендую всем хотя бы попробовать.

ostin ★★★★★
()
Ответ на: комментарий от samy_volosaty

не знаю как это, а студия-2015 убила, поставил в виртуалке посмотреть: вид жуткий, жрёт кучу ресурсов. через месяц протухла (а кто-то кричал тут, что бесплатно раздают)

Бесплатно Community верисю раздают.

anonymous
()
Ответ на: комментарий от FiXer

У тебя на аватарке тоже ничего так жрет :) А так да, 25 гб откушать может.

spec_po_kiskam ★★★
() автор топика
Ответ на: комментарий от tailgunner

Точно, ты скорее Рядовой Очевидность.Это же надо придумать, байткод с языком высокого уровня сравнивать.

spec_po_kiskam ★★★
() автор топика

У меня в течении пару часов несколько раз обращался к следующим хостам: spynetalt.microsoft.com statsfe1.ws.microsoft.com.nsatc.net telemetry.urs.microsoft.com

Думал такая хрень только на винде у них.

anonymous
()
Ответ на: комментарий от spec_po_kiskam

Это же надо придумать, байткод с языком высокого уровня сравнивать.

Это же надо придумать - интересоваться тем, что на выходе кодогенератора.

tailgunner ★★★★★
()
Ответ на: комментарий от anonymous

У меня в течении пару часов несколько раз обращался к следующим хостам: spynetalt.microsoft.com statsfe1.ws.microsoft.com.nsatc.net telemetry.urs.microsoft.com

Думал такая хрень только на винде у них.

Это обычный сбор метаданных. Сейчас практически все серьезные программы это делают. Если боишься, то только шапочка из фольги тебе поможет.

anonymous
()
Ответ на: комментарий от anonymous

Хотел поменять саблайм на вот это вот поделие и обнаружил фатальный недостаток - отсутствие вкладок.

В этой версии должны были завести вкладки /табы

grim ★★☆☆
()
Ответ на: комментарий от spec_po_kiskam

Слив защитан.

Я знал, что ты скажешь это.

TS генерирует читаемый JS для того чтобы его, собственно, читали.

Конечно. А у некоторых компиляторов Си была опция вывода читаемого ассемблера. Но вот редактировать его не предполагалось.

tailgunner ★★★★★
()
Ответ на: комментарий от RazrFalcon

VSC не пробовал

И зачем же тогда воюете против того чего даже не видели?

atom дико глючный

Он и сейчас иногда доставляет.

VSCode гораздо лучше.

И все-же попробуйте прежде чем глупости писать.

grim ★★☆☆
()
Ответ на: комментарий от tailgunner

Эта опция для того, чтобы когда тебя задолбает наркомания в тайпскрипте, ты мог собрать свой нагенереный JS и выкинуть Typescript из проекта. Тем самым нету никакого lock-in. Что побуждает больше людей использовать этот язык.

spec_po_kiskam ★★★
() автор топика
Ответ на: комментарий от spec_po_kiskam

По-моему, вы не понимаете сути ЛОРа ;)

У каждого свой ЛОР.

Мой ЛОР я пытаюсь улучшить.

grim ★★☆☆
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.